18 lines
575 B
C#
18 lines
575 B
C#
|
|
using Meezi.Core.Enums;
|
||
|
|
|
||
|
|
namespace Meezi.Core.Entities;
|
||
|
|
|
||
|
|
public class SubscriptionPayment : TenantEntity
|
||
|
|
{
|
||
|
|
public PlanTier PlanTier { get; set; }
|
||
|
|
public int Months { get; set; }
|
||
|
|
public decimal AmountToman { get; set; }
|
||
|
|
public long AmountRials { get; set; }
|
||
|
|
public PaymentProvider Provider { get; set; } = PaymentProvider.ZarinPal;
|
||
|
|
public string? Authority { get; set; }
|
||
|
|
public string? RefId { get; set; }
|
||
|
|
public SubscriptionPaymentStatus Status { get; set; } = SubscriptionPaymentStatus.Pending;
|
||
|
|
|
||
|
|
public Cafe Cafe { get; set; } = null!;
|
||
|
|
}
|